Children's Hanfu Hair Accessories
Children's Hanfu hair accessories are designed with the specific needs of young wearers in mind. These are often made from soft and gentle materials that are comfortable for children to wear for extended periods of time. The designs are often vibrant and colorful, featuring popular cartoon characters or traditional symbols that children can easily identify with.
One of the most popular children's Hanfu hair accessories is the hairband. These come in various styles, from the traditional silk-wrapped hairband to the more modern elastic ones. The hairbands are often adorned with small ornaments such as beads, crystals, or even small Chinese knots, which not only make them more visually appealing but also provide additional comfort.
Another popular option is the hairpin, which can be used to secure the hair in place while also adding a decorative element to the look. These hairpins are often crafted in the shape of flowers or animals and are often made from wood or metal, ensuring durability and longevity.
